Some observers have welcomed the ruling, arguing that regulators have allowed tech companies to amass too much power by scaling through acquisitions. “We feel that there has been over a decade of under-enforcement,” says Max von Thun, Europe director at think tank Open Markets, referring to past decisions to let Facebook merge with WhatsApp and Instagram. “Our concern would be that by having the Activision catalog, Microsoft would get an unchallengeable advantage in this market over other cloud gaming services.”
